Convolutional neural networks in paediatric fracture detection: pooled evidence from a systematic review and meta-analysis

    Fractures are common in children, with significant morbidity, making accurate and timely diagnosis essential to prevent complications.

    AI, particularly convolutional neural networks, shows promise in improving diagnostic accuracy for paediatric fractures on X-rays.

    Current research on AI for paediatric fracture detection is limited, with concerns about heterogeneity and generalizability of findings.

    The systematic review aimed to evaluate the diagnostic accuracy of AI models for detecting paediatric appendicular fractures.

    The study followed PRISMA-DTA guidelines and focused on sensitivity, specificity, and other accuracy metrics per radiograph.
